N4032F OSFP configuration to receive default route (switch is a stub)

Hey everyone. Having some difficulty in getting the default route that our Juniper MX router is sending to this Dell switch to show up in the routing table. The juniper has the OSPF area the Dell is in configured as a stub and is injecting the default-metric 10 into the routes. However, I don't see it on the Dell if I remove the static default route, it has no path out.

I am assuming that I don't have something set correctly on the N4032 as I am not real familiar with how OSPF is setup on them. Additionally, the reason we need this is that there are 2 juniper MX routers using 2 different areas connected to the N4032s and the N4032s are a switch stack.

Does anyone have some config examples or guide links that you can share to assist with this?
